Options For Virtual Planning

While going to the funeral home for a tour and in-person planning sessions is still an option, if you are more comfortable keeping your distance, or if perhaps you live out of the area, you can plan everything that you need to plan virtually. You can have phone calls, video conferences, and anything else you need to get the job done from a distance. Much of the initial paperwork can even be filled out online.

 

Livestreaming Options

You might not want to gather all of your family members for an in-person service during this uncertain time. You can, however, have a smaller service and then livestream that service to family members who can watch from the safety and comfort of their own home. Everyone can participate, but there are fewer risks involved for even those attending with less people there.

 

Hand Sanitizing Stations

Funeral homes have stations throughout their facilities, normally with water and tissues, but now, they also include hand sanitizer. Any time anyone comes into contact with someone else, they have the opportunity to sanitize their hands whenever they feel necessary to do so.
